One of the biggest sources of confusion for UK fishkeepers is the distinction between gallons. If a producer specifies a tank is "50 gallons," it is essential to know which system they are using.
Litres (L): The basic metric system utilized mainly in the UK and Europe. The majority of contemporary UK aquarium specifications are listed in litres.Imperial Gallons (Imp Gal): The traditional British system of measurement. One Imperial gallon is significantly larger than a United States gallon.United States Gallons (US Gal): Commonly used on international online forums, YouTube tutorials, and by manufacturers based in North America.Quick Comparison TableSystemComparable in LitresComparable in US GallonsEquivalent in Imperial Gallons1 Litre1 L0.264 United States Gal0.220 Imp Gal1 US Gallon3.785 L1 US Gal0.833 Imp Gal1 Imperial Gallon4.546 L1.201 US Gal1 Imp GalHow to Calculate Aquarium Volume Manually
To determine the volume of a basic rectangular Aquarium Water Calculator, one needs to determine the internal measurements in centimeters or inches.
The Formula for Rectangular Tanks (in Centimetres)
₤ ₤ \ text Volume (Litres) = \ frac \ text Length (cm) \ times \ text Width (cm) \ times \ text Height (cm) 1000 ₤ ₤
Example Calculation:
Imagine a standard UK Juwel-style tank determining 80 cm long, 35 cm wide, and 40 cm high.
Multiply the measurements: ₤ 80 \ times 35 \ times 40 = 112,000 ₤ cubic centimeters.Divide by 1,000: ₤ 112,000/ 1,000 = \ textbf 112 Litres ₤.To transform Litres to Imperial Gallons, divide by 4.546: ₤ 112/ 4.546 = \ textbf 24.6 Imp Gallons ₤.The Reality of "Net" vs. "Gross" Volume
When using an aquarium volume calculator, it is important to understand the distinction between Gross Volume and Net Volume.
Gross Volume: The absolute maximum quantity of water the glass box can hold if filled to the absolute brim.Net Volume: The actual quantity of water in the tank once design, equipment, and substrate are factored in.
Substrate (gravel or sand), big pieces of driftwood, rock scapes (like Seiryu stone or dragon stone), and 3D backgrounds all displace a surprising amount of water. Additionally, most aquariums are not filled right to the very top-- there is normally a space of 2 to 5 centimetres at the surface.
Normal Displacement EstimatesFine Sand/ Gravel substrate: Deduct roughly 10% to 15% from gross volume.Heavy Aquascapes (Lots of rock and wood): Deduct approximately 15% to 20% from gross volume.Lightly planted community tanks: Deduct approximately 10% from gross volume.Types of Aquarium Shapes and Their Formulas
Not all fish tanks are simple rectangle-shaped boxes. Hexagonal, bow-front, and round tanks require customized solutions to determine accurately.
1. Bow-Front Tanks
Bow-front tanks include a curved front glass panel, making manual computations challenging.
The Manual Method: Measure the flat back and sides as a rectangle. For the curved front, determine the inmost point of the bow, determine the area of the resulting section, and add it to the base rectangle.The Easy Method: Use an online digital calculator developed specifically for bow-front fish tanks.2. Cylindrical Tanks
Popular for contemporary, minimalist setups, cylinders require the formula for the volume of a cylinder.₤ ₤ \ text Volume (Litres) = \ pi \ times \ text Radius ^ 2 \ times \ text Height/ 1000 ₤ ₤.( Note: Radius is half of the tank's diameter).
3. Hexagonal Tanks
Hex tanks include aesthetic appeal however less swimming space.
The Formula: Calculated by finding the location of the routine hexagon base and multiplying it by the water height, then converting to litres.Benefits of Using an Online Aquarium Volume Calculator

Before filling a newly calculated tank, keep these useful ideas in mind:
Measure Internal Dimensions: Always measure the inside of the glass, not the outdoors, to represent glass thickness.Inspect Floor Strength: Water is heavy-- one litre weighs approximately one kg (plus the weight of the glass, stand, and rocks). A 200-litre tank weighs a quarter of a tonne. Guarantee the floor covering can support it, particularly on upper-floor flats in older UK residential or commercial properties.Account for Filtration Space: Sump systems include extra water volume listed below the display screen tank, which should be consisted of in total system calculations.
